    Are deals really cheaper on Prime Day? 

    The legitimacy of Prime Day is a hotly debated topic every year. Prime Day does have some legit deals, usually on flagship Amazon products like Fire TVs, Echo devices, Kindles, and more. However, the best way to ensure you’re getting an actual deal is to prepare to shop for offers and use price tracking tools to make sure you don’t fall victim to brands marking up items to “discount’ them later. 

    What are Lightning Deals?

    Amazon’s lightning deals are limited-time promotional offers on products. Often these products have limited quantities available at the discounted price. Once it’s 100% claimed, the offer becomes expired. Lightning deals typically last anywhere from 4-12 hours and can vary significantly. A status bar tells you how many Prime members have claimed a lightning deal. For example, here’s a live example of a lightning deal at Amazon as of Oct. 7.

    Amazon Prime Day vs. Black Friday: Which has better deals? 

    While Amazon Prime Day has deals exclusive to Prime members, Black Friday deals are available across all retailers and are available to anyone. Some of the lowest prices we’ve ever seen products discounted at have been during Black Friday sales events. However, we consistently notice that Amazon products are priced lower during Prime Day events, so now is a better time to buy Kindles, Fire TVs, Echo devices, etc. 

    How can you fact-check Prime Day deals?

    To find out if a deal is actually legit or worth your money, you can use deal trackers like Keepa and Camel Camel Camel that are easy to use and download. At ZDNET, we use Camel Camel Camel to track a product’s price differences over time and compare the lowest price to the highest price.
